The cheapest way to get from Newark to Liberty is to drive which costs $18 - $27 and takes 1h 58m.
The fastest way to get from Newark to Liberty is to drive which takes 1h 58m and costs $18 - $27.
No, there is no direct bus from Newark station to Liberty. However, there are services departing from Newark Penn Station and arriving at 76 S. Main St - Liberty via Port Authority Bus Terminal and Government Center / Sturgis Rd.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 53m.
The distance between Newark and Liberty is 109 miles. The road distance is 100.5 miles.
The best way to get from Newark to Liberty without a car is to train and taxi which takes 3h 22m and costs $190 - $280.
It takes approximately 3h 22m to get from Newark to Liberty, including transfers.
Newark to Liberty bus services, operated by NJ Transit, depart from Newark Penn Station.
Newark to Liberty bus services, operated by NJ Transit, arrive at Port Authority Bus Terminal station.
Yes, the driving distance between Newark to Liberty is 101 miles. It takes approximately 1h 58m to drive from Newark to Liberty.
